> BTW. Why people still cling to i386?
Unluckily there are some binary things which work only in i386.
A friend of mine need a VM to run ports/databases/oracle8-client.
Another thing which I think could force people n i386 is adobe
software(this is true in linux too).
There may be other examples around.
